Transaction 16ebb506527d4bb5178cef2efcfaac32ec9ca77f1593dfe6a9b2a20f9633d52a
1 Input
2 Outputs
- 16ebb506527d4bb5178cef2efcfaac32ec9ca77f1593dfe6a9b2a20f9633d52a:0
- 16ebb506527d4bb5178cef2efcfaac32ec9ca77f1593dfe6a9b2a20f9633d52a:1
value 3030812
address 1DUfCJsnZR6Yr6ixpaFQXgp35sPFfhr1uL
value 1142704
address 3LmQkRutB5sBpH8u5RwCxLpZRWsb5cppyj